CDS Anil Chauhan

In honour of the country's first Chief of Defence Staff, General Anil Chauhan is visiting the Defence Services Staff College in Wellington on Tuesday, where he will deliver the lecture that his predecessor was supposed to give but was unable to due to a helicopter crash.

Gen Rawat, his wife Madhulika Rawat and 12 other military personnel were killed in a helicopter crash on 8 December 2021, while en route to Wellington to deliver a speech.

“Gen Anil Chauhan is visiting the Defence Staff College in Wellington today to deliver a speech in memory of late Gen Rawat,” defence officials said.

The current CDS worked closely with Gen Rawat as Director General of Military Operations and then as Commander of the Eastern Army.

In October of this year, Gen Chauhan was chosen to succeed Gen Rawat as Chief of Defence Staff.

Gen Chauhan will also accompany the families of all the soldiers whose family members died in the chopper crash on 8 December last year, to the National War Memorial.

The Indian Navy has also announced that the trophies for the best Agniveer trainee will be named after the late CDS.

On 8 December, National Security Advisor Ajit Doval and Gen Chauhan will launch a book about Gen Bipin Rawat.

On 10 December, the Indian Army will also hold a memorial lecture for the late CDS.

After taking off from Sulur in Tamil Nadu, Gen Rawat and his wife Madhulika Rawat were killed when their helicopter crashed into a hill amid heavy cloud cover.
